If stocks were truly bullish, then markets in the US and Europe hadn't taken any pause in rallying strongly higher today - one day after the Brexit negotiation talks officially started on June 19, 2017. Also on Monday the "VIX" index and also the "SKEW" index closed both green together on the same day while the "S&P 500" and"Dow Jones Industrial Average" both made a new all-time high. That was very odd. This tells me the peak of complacency might be near, at least for the near-term.

Trade closed: target reached:
Target hit twice: My minimum short target of 2410, which I had set on June 20 has been achieved two times in the last five days.

On June 29 the S&P 500 reached a low of 2405.70 and yesterday on July 06 it made a higher low at 2407.70 and closed at 2409.75 right below my 2410 short target.

Today the S&P 500 opened higher and is currently trading above 2415, which implies we have seen the lows of this week already. Therefore I recommend to close the majority of shorts (opened at my short entry recommendation of 2440-2450), because next week the S&P 500 has now higher odds of going upwards again.
